Juventus are prepared to sell reported Liverpool target Paulo Dybala this summer, according to Goal.

Italian publication Tuttosport claimed earlier this year that Liverpool are interested in signing the Argentine, although the Old Lady value the forward at around £105 million.

Dybala is one of Europe’s most exciting attackers, but he has experienced somewhat of a difficult campaign in Turin since Cristiano Ronaldo arrived last summer, with just five Serie A goals to his name.

The 25-year-old is still a wonderful talent, however, and a move to Anfield might be just what he needs in order to reinvigorate his career.

Liverpool already have three excellent forward players, but the addition of another really could take them to another level.

Dyabla would provide more competition for Roberto Firmino though the middle, and he could even be deployed as a number 10 behind the Brazilian, offering Jurgen Klopp an entirely different option.
